Government Expenditures on Communication

This key economic indicator for the Telecom sector has been recently updated.

  1. Germany was up 8.9% of Government Expenditures on Communication in 2017, compared to a year earlier.
  2. Since 2014 Japan Government Expenditures on Communication grew 3.7% year on year totalising $2,194.87 Million PPP.
  3. In 2019 Spain was number 2 in Government Expenditures on Communication.
